This is a beautiful example of a late 19th to early 20th-century German wall clock, likely produced by Junghans or a similar Black Forest maker. The case is expertly crafted from walnut with ornate architectural carvings, including turned spindles, acanthus leaf accents, and a pediment-style cornice. The brass dial features a floral repoussé center surrounded by a porcelain-style chapter ring with bold Arabic numerals, paired with a swinging pendulum depicting a romanticized figure on a swing. Mechanically, the clock features a brass movement and a coiled gong chime. The wood case shows areas where decorative elements need to be re-secured or glued, particularly at the cornice; the movement is reported to be operational but has not been tested for long-term timekeeping accuracy. H 32", W 16", D 8". Please see photos for condition.
